Unveiling Architectural Visions: The Power of 3D Modeling

In the dynamic realm within architecture, where creativity and innovation meld, 3D modeling has emerged as a transformative tool. This cutting-edge technology empowers architects to visualize their designs in stunning detail, bringing their architectural visions vividly. With its ability to represent spatial interactions, 3D modeling provides invaluable insights into the form of a building. From intricate details to expansive structures, architects can now explore their designs from every angle, enhancing them before physical construction even begins.

The benefits derived from 3D modeling are manifold. It allows for seamless communication between architects, clients, and contractors, fostering a collaborative environment. Moreover, 3D models permit the identification of potential design flaws or issues at an early stage, preventing costly revisions down the line. As technology continues to advance, the influence of 3D modeling in architecture is only set to increase, shaping the future in the built environment.
